B. Teen Cupcake Challenge
i. Recreation Coordinator I, Hilary Kleiman, confirmed that the Teen
Cupcake Challenge scheduled on November 8 was cancelled due to
lack of registration and reminded Teen Council members to promote the
next Teen Cupcake Challenge on January 31, 2025 via social media,
word of mouth, and by passing out flyers. Teen Council members
suggested promoting through Moorpark High School's broadcasting
program called "Musketeer Mornings".
ii. Recreation Coordinator I, Hilary Kleiman, acknowledged that the lack of
registration could have been due to the Moorpark High School football
team's playoff game on the same evening, and while playoff games
aren't typically scheduled in advance with the regular season, suggested
looking ahead at any conflicting school events while scheduling teen
events to mitigate cancellations due to low enrollment.
